I have always been fascinated with the ever changing and evolving world of art. Since when I was a child, I would always find myself drawing and scribbling on any medium. Be it on the dining table, the wall, paper, or even on the floor. I do not know exactly how I developed this interest, however, upon realizing my growing love for art; I have committed myself to always strive to improve my artistic talents. Hence, I have enrolled in various art classes since elementary school. Through out the years, a considerable amount of achievements and successes in art competitions have testified about my artistic abilities. Nevertheless, I am still learning, and have not brought forth my true potentials yet. Previously, I won the first prize for the Pentel Children's Art Competition in 1995. Later, obtaining a bronze medal for the Tokyo's International Children's Art Competition. This was followed by a short string of successes in newspaper competitions; such as winning a restaurant voucher at KFC in the Leader Newspaper for rendering a picture of the Beatles with a tiger in black and white. Winning first prize for depicting a flood scene in poster colour in the "Minda Pelajar" newspaper, and others. Personally, I am more attracted to figure drawing. But this was not so at the beginning. I used to draw and paint many robot characters from the Transformers cartoon series, until a classmate commented that I am only capable of depicting mechanic robots. Since then, I began drawing many other subjects apart from robots. As time past by, I was drawn to the human figure from comics and other mass media. Portraying figures in various poses and expressions soon became very enjoyable and expressive in creativity for me. Leonardo da Vinci, Raphael, Jim Lee, Travis Charest, and Alex Ross are the artists that influenced me most. Cartoons, comics, animations, motion pictures, and novels also played a great part in shaping my artistic preferences and styles. But, most of all, The Lord is my greatest influence. Without Him, I can do nothing. Currently, I am studying a business course from Curtin University of Technology (Australia); majoring in marketing and management at Metropolitan College in Malaysia. Drawing and illustrating has become more of a hobby for me these days. Once every now and then, I get to do some freelance illustrations and graphic design work for other people.
